Okay, so it's really a fan-made concept, based on rumors and the split second glimpse we get of it in the new trailer. But it's too damn cool not to share! I mean, a giant mutated whale?!? Awesome.

This was found on the Unfiction Message Boards, where the crazy people over there are analyzing every single clue about Cloverfield possible! There's a lot of fun theories and topics on the boards. Check 'em out!